Allen v. Hubbard Trucking Inc., 94-STA-29 (Sec'y Apr. 19, 1995)



DATE:  April 19, 1995
CASE NO. 94-STA-29


IN THE MATTER OF

MARC R. ALLEN,
          COMPLAINANT,

     v.

HUBBARD TRUCKING, INC.,
          RESPONDENT.


BEFORE:   THE SECRETARY OF LABOR


                         FINAL ORDER OF DISMISSAL

     On March 17, 1995, I issued an Order to Show Cause in this
case which arises under the employee protection provision of the
Surface Transportation Assistance Act of 1982, 49 U.S.C.A.
§ 31105 (West 1994).  The parties were directed to show
cause within ten days of receipt of the order, why this case
should not be dismissed pursuant to 29 C.F.R. §
18.6(d)(2)(v) (1994).  The prescribed period has expired and
neither party has responded.
     Accordingly, pursuant to Section 18.6(d)(2)(v), this case IS
DISMISSED.
     SO ORDERED.
